cuitongrui 发表于 2016-12-16 10:52:55

oracle循环应用(多变量)

老师,您好,比如我现在有个循环语句如下,只有一个i变量,我还想在此语句中加一个j变量,j变量赋值为5,j变量自动增加3,应该如何来表达?谢谢!
declare
i NUMBER;
begin
for i in 1..50 loop
INSERT INTO ctr VALUES('7000'+i);
end LOOP;
END;

oraask2 发表于 2016-12-16 23:35:45

DECLARE
V_C NUMBER :=5 ;
BEGIN
FOR I IN 1..50
LOOP
V_C :=V_C+I*3 ;
DBMS_OUTPUT.PUT_LINE(I);
END LOOP ;
END ;

甲骨小弟 发表于 2017-10-31 15:01:00

老师解答的厉害
页: [1]
查看完整版本: oracle循环应用(多变量)